NVIDIA has launched its most powerful open AI model for robotaxis, named Alpamayo 2 Super, which is three times larger than its predecessor, featuring 32 billion parameters. This advanced AI enhances the vehicle’s capabilities by allowing it to understand its surroundings in 360 degrees, better perceive 3D spatial contexts, and make more informed driving decisions in complex scenarios. With AI models like these, NVIDIA supports quicker iterations in the training and validation of autonomous systems, reflecting the growing integration of their technology into robotaxi platforms to improve real-time perception and control.

Alpamayo 2 Super: Alpamayo 2 Super is NVIDIA’s advanced open AI model tailored for autonomous driving applications including robotaxis. It expands on prior versions with improved 360-degree environmental awareness, three-dimensional spatial understanding, and safer handling of complex or rare road scenarios. The model also supports automated data labeling and provides explanations for its driving choices to aid development and safety reviews.
